Transaction 72a52170d6caf64da32a1edfa1654c47c115ca93fe56dc6cb039903ce8686872

1 Input
2 Outputs
  • 72a52170d6caf64da32a1edfa1654c47c115ca93fe56dc6cb039903ce8686872:0
  • value  459963990
    address  39hNwjhdDygTX9T5xchj4Sy2KZxgEtBND7
  • 72a52170d6caf64da32a1edfa1654c47c115ca93fe56dc6cb039903ce8686872:1
  • value  500000000
    address  3DTTHeWLY5RyjBnQWA88wFPnPWRFKw4e25